EA Sports PGA Tour Receives US Open Update

By: | Thu 15 Jun 2023


Since its launch in April, the game developer has been nurturing the early development of EA Sports PGA Tour.

Having launched with a plethora of courses - and a truly superb career mode - it is now time for the latest update to the game.

Title Update 4.0

The latest patch from EA Sports celebrates the imminent US Open that will be taking place from June 15.

Los Angeles Country Club - host of this year’s championship - has been loaded into the game and players can experience what awaits the professionals.

Furthermore, new challenges will be released across the tournament, where gamers will be tasked with recreating prominent shots from this year’s event.

As an additional bonus, the update will also iron out stability issues whilst also implementing quality of life features - including updated Swing Meter visuals.

Father’s Day Weekend

EA Sports PGA Tour will be available to try for free on consoles during the US Open in celebration of Father’s Day weekend.

Access will be issued from Thursday, June 15 before the trial period comes to an end on Sunday, June 18.

Players on both PS5 and Xbox Series S/X will be able to enjoy limited free access to the impressive game.
